In the EU that Disney scrubbed from canon, Luke was (understandably and obviously) the primary focus of most of the stories being told. Now, in Disney's canon, he has only shown up a handful of times - the two that I am aware of being once in the Mandalorian Season 2, and once in Battlefront 2 (which is canon, I think)?
The most obvious reason for this is that Mark Hamill isn't young anymore, and the best we can get is either an animated appearance or a CG appearance. CG appearances also understandably would have to be used sparingly, as I don't think the tech is there for anything past a low-key performance (I don't think a higher range of emotion would translate well).
